At existing, Android controls the around the world smart device os market. The data posted on numerous sites suggest that Google Play Store currently uses even more applications as well as games than Apple Play Store. The patterns portray that many developers prefer creating apps as well as video games for the Android platform.
The designers have option to create applications and also video games for Android in C, C++ or Java. But Java is the official language for establishing video games and apps for Google’s mobile os. Google further suggests designers to write brand-new Android applications and also video games in Java. Additionally, lots of developers find it simpler to create mobile video games in Java than various other programs languages.
Why Several Designers like creating Mobile Gamings in Java?
slotxo is a Popular Shows Language
The developers have alternative to use Java for creating desktop GUI applications, internet applications as well as mobile applications. That is why; business can develop mobile apps quickly by releasing skilled Java programmers.
Java is a Multithreaded Shows Language
Developers constantly prefer creating mobile games in a programs language that supports multithreading totally. The multithreading assistance is vital for performing several jobs concurrently within a single program. So the customers can conveniently play the mobile games created in Java while carrying out other tasks like checking emails and surfing web. The multitasking assistance makes it less complicated for designers to develop games that permit individuals to switch over from one task to one more flawlessly.
Promotes Cross-Platform Game Advancement
Unlike other programming languages, Java makes it possible for developers to port applications from one platform to an additional perfectly. They designers can create the mobile video game in Java when, as well as run it on multiple devices and systems without recompiling the code as well as utilizing additional implementation dependences. It comes to be simpler for programmers to develop the mobile game at first for the Android operating system, as well as reuse the very same code to expand the video game to other mobile systems.
Aids Developers to Build Remarkable Gamings
Like mobile applications, mobile games likewise require to function flawlessly as well as supply richer customer experience to come to be preferred as well as profitable. Unlike various other programs languages, Java allows programmers to determine and also eliminate coding errors early as well as promptly.
Functions Included in Java 2 Micro Version (J2ME).
While composing mobile games in Java, the designers can take benefit of the robust features given by Java 2 Micro Edition (J2ME). The newest variation of MIDP API comes with several new attributes to make mobile video game growth easier as well as faster.
The developers can further use Java runtime setting and collections to make the video game run flawlessly on various mobile tools. The designers can use J2ME to allow customers to play the video games also when there is no web connection.
Lots of Video Game Development Devices.
The developers can better avail a variety of devices to develop 2D as well as 3D mobile video games in Java rapidly. For instance, the designers can utilize innovative 3D game engines like jMonkeyEngine to develop magnificent 3D worlds. These tools better boost the performance of Java games significantly, as well as makes it possible for designers to port the games to various platforms.
Some of these tools even permit programmers to write durable video games in Java using extensively made use of integrated development settings (IDEs) like NetBeans and also Eclipse. These game advancement tools add profoundly towards making Java mobile game advancement prominent.
The Java developers likewise have choice to make use of a number of mobile video game growth tools to develop durable video games in Java within a much shorter amount of time. The collection of 2D as well as 3D tools given by these frameworks make it much easier for designers to produce video games that provide richer user experience throughout several devices powered by the Android operating system.
Lots of designers find it much easier to compose mobile video games in Java than other programming languages.
It ends up being much easier for developers to develop the mobile game initially for the Android operating system, as well as reuse the very same code to extend the game to various other mobile systems.
While composing mobile games in Java, the designers can take advantage of the durable functions supplied by Java 2 Micro Edition (J2ME). The developers can additionally obtain a number of devices to develop 2D as well as 3D mobile games in Java rapidly. These tools better enhance the efficiency of Java video games significantly, and allows programmers to port the video games to various systems.